WHAT IT WAS WAS FOOTBALL ... JMU 70-50 OVER UNC
How bad could it have been at Chapel Hill Saturday had not
James Madison been penalized eight times for 85 yards in
the FIRST HALF, for crying out loud? By then the Dukes led
53-21 … and had lost a fumble deep in UNC territory …
“Maybe a little bit stunning,” said ACCNetwork halftime
host TAYLOR APPLEBAUM. Maybe? A little bit? Where
do they get these people from anyway? … Thank goodness
for former Virginia Tech wideout EDDIE ROYAL who said
what needed to be said: “Just sloppy football ... They’re
getting out-coached … It’s frustrating to watch. BAD
FOOTBALL!” … By the time the teams returned for the
second half, most of the Carolina faithful had left Kenan
Stadium … leaving about 47,000 empty seats to watch JMU
complete the rout 70-50 … despite remaining undisciplined
… and finishing with 12 penalties for 105 yards … Granted,
the Dukes had reason to wonder about some of the decisions
by the ACC officiating crew … like roughing the passer
(negated by intentional grounding) at the Madison 15 , and
Carolina scored on the next snap to close to 60-32 midway
of the third quarter… but moving well before the snap on
fourth and two was an easy call … one of six for illegal
motion against JMU ...“What do make of this stunning
event?” asked play by player Jorge Sedano … to which
analyst (of the obvious) Orlando Franklin said, “The guys
aren’t doing their jobs.” Who would have known? … Click!
Lingering impressions from JMU/Carolina … Despite JMU
having the all-time most points (60, midway through the
third quarter) against a FBS opponent, first-year coach BOB
CHESNEY should not have been in a mood to celebrate
afterwards. Aside from the myriad of penalties, his defense
against the pass was shoddy, and the tackling even worse …
Also, the Dukes spent too much time and energy hot-
dogging, especially when things were going well in the first
half … and could have picked up even more flags for delay
of game as well as taunting. Then again that is what football
has become … Hey, everybody. LOOK AT ME! … and Big

Finally, let’s hear it for Carolina’s Mack Brown, who told it
like it was … and didn’t cut short his post-game press
conference like so many coaches do after an exceptionally
bad day at the office. To paraphrase … he said everyone was
embarrassed and that he was responsible. The fans should
have booed and walked out at halftime (which they did) ...
when their team plays that poorly, especially against an
opponent they were better than ... and should have beaten.
